Le Pain Quotidien on the Upper East Side holds a current Grade A from NYC DOHMH, scoring 9 points on its most recent inspection. Across 4 inspections from 2023 to 2025, the restaurant has received Grade A every time, with no emergency closures on record.

L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N in Upper East Side Yorkville: Frequently Asked Questions
- When was L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N last inspected?
- L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N was last inspected on September 24, 2025 (Grade A). The inspection score was 9 points.
- What is L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N's current health grade?
- L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N currently holds a Grade A. This is the highest possible grade, indicating a score of 0–13 points.
- How many health inspections has L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N had?
- L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N has 4 health inspections on record from January 2023 through September 2025. The restaurant received Grade A on 3 occasions.
- What was the worst inspection score at L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N?
- The worst inspection score recorded at L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N was 29 points on January 12, 2023. In NYC, a score of 14 or above means Grade B, and 28+ means Grade C.
- Has L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N ever received a Grade C?
- No. LE PAIN QUOTIDIEN has not received a Grade C in the inspections on record.
